THE FLAG OF MACEDONIA

THE FLAG OF MACEDONIA IS BLACK AND RED BECAUSE THE COUNTRY'S
HISTORY HAS BEEN SHROUDED IN THE BLOOD AND DESPAIR OF THE PEOPLE.
THIS HAS BEEN LEGEND SINCE ALEXANDER THE GREAT CURSED MACEDON.

Submitter comment: JIM LEARNED THIS FROM HIS GRANDPARENTS.

LEGEND ABOUT THE ORIGIN OF POLAND

THERE WAS AN OLD MAN AND HE LIVED IN ASIA AND HE HAD THREE SONS
WHOSE NAMES WERE LECH, CZECH AND RUS. AND THE OLD MAN DIED AND
HE DIDN'T LEAVE HIS SONS ANYTHING, SO THEY HAD TO GO OUT INTO THE
WORLD TO SEEK THEIR FORTUNES. SO THEY WENT TO EUROPE AND RUS
WENT NORTH AND FOUNDED RUSSIA AND CZECH WENT SOUTH AND FOUNDED
CZECHOSLOVAKIA. LECH KEPT GOING AND NIGHT CAME AND HE FOUND
HIMSELF IN A CIRCLE AROUND A CLEARING AND HE SAID, "I WILL ESTAB-
LISH A COUNTRY AND THIS WILL BE THE SYMBOL ON MY BANNER." AND
THIS IS HOW THE COUNTRY OF POLAND ORIGINATED.

Submitter comment: SHE LEARNED IT FROM PAN NOWAK WHO TAUGHT HER POLISH.

THE DEVIL ON SEYBURN

AS A LITTLE GIRL THE INFORMANT LIVED ON SEYBURN IN DETROIT. ON
ONE OF THE CORNERS OF SEYBURN THERE WAS A HOUSE WHICH HAD BEEN
POSSESSED BY THE DEVIL. WHEN THE PRIEST DROVE THE DEVIL FROM THE
HOUSE, HE CHASED IT INTO THE GARAGE. THE DEVIL RAN ACROSS THE
FLOOR UP THE WALL AND HALF WAY ACROSS THE CEILING BEFORE LEAVING.
THERE ARE IMPRINTS OF HIS FOOT IN THE CEMENT FLOOR OF THE GARAGE.
ON THE WALL AND ON THE CEILING THERE ARE HAND AND BELLY PRINTS.
THESE PRINTS CANNOT BE REMOVED WITH PAINT OR BY RECEMENTING THE
FLOOR. THEY ALWAYS REAPPEAR. THE INFORMANT HAS SEEN THE PRINTS
HERSELF.

MARINE HISTORIC EVENT

THE REASON THAT OFFICERS HAVE X'S ON THE TOP OF THEIR HATS DATES
BACK TO THE BATTLE OF THE BONHOMME RICHARD AND THE SERAPIS. THERE
WERE MARINE SNIPERS IN THE RIGGING AND THEY HAD THE MARINES PUT
X'S ON THEIR HATS SO THEY WOULDN'T GET SHOT.

HAUNTED HOUSE

IN BARABOO, WISCONSIN, WHEN I WAS VERY YOUNG, THERE WAS A
HAUNTED HOUSE ON OUR BLOCK AND WE KEPT SEEING PEOPLE IN WHITE
WALKING AROUND IN THERE, AND DOGS HOWLING UP THERE AT NIGHT.

GHOSTLY LIGHT

IN BOSTON, IT IS SAID THAT THERE ARE NIGHTS WHEN THE LIGHT CAN BE
SEEN FROM THE NORTH CHURCH--THE CHURCH FROM WHICH CAME THE SIGNAL
BY LIGHT THAT THE BRITISH WERE COMING.

TALE

WHEN PAT'S PARENTS FIRST LIVED IN THEIR NEW HOUSE, THEY COULD
HEAR MOANS AND CRIES IN THEIR BEDROOM. THEY LATER FOUND OUT
THAT THE PREVIOUS OWNER HAD DIED AND REMAINED THERE FOR SEVERAL
DAYS UNTIL FOUND. THE MOANS CONTINUED UNTIL THE NAME OF THE
PREVIOUS OWNER WAS REMOVED FROM THE MAILBOX.

IF YOUR DRESS IS TURNED UP ON THE END, YOU KISS IT
AND YOU'LL GET ANOTHER DRESS.
